Understanding Cockroaches
Before delving into the specifics of citrus oils, it’s essential to understand what cockroaches are and why they are such persistent pests. Cockroaches are insects belonging to the order Blattodea, with over 4,500 species worldwide. Among these, only a few species invade human habitats, including the German cockroach, American cockroach, and Oriental cockroach.
Health Risks Associated with Cockroaches
Cockroaches are known carriers of pathogens that can lead to various diseases in humans. They can contaminate food and surfaces with bacteria, allergens, and pathogens like Salmonella and E. coli. Moreover, their droppings and body parts can trigger allergic reactions or asthma attacks in sensitive individuals.
Traditional Methods of Cockroach Control
Traditional pest control typically involves insecticides that are designed to kill cockroaches on contact or through ingestion. While these methods can be effective, they often come with significant downsides:
- Health Risks: Many synthetic chemicals pose risks to human health and require careful handling.
- Environmental Impact: Chemical insecticides can harm beneficial insects and pollute ecosystems.
- Resistance: Over time, cockroaches may develop resistance to certain chemical treatments, making them less effective.
These concerns have led to an increased interest in more natural solutions like citrus oils.
The Science Behind Citrus Oils
Citrus oils are essential oils extracted from citrus fruits such as oranges, lemons, and grapefruits. The primary active compounds in these oils include limonene, citral, and linalool. These compounds possess insecticidal properties that can deter or kill various pests, including cockroaches.
Mechanism of Action
The effectiveness of citrus oils against cockroaches can be attributed to several mechanisms:
-
Repellent Properties: Citrus oils emit strong scents that are unpleasant for cockroaches. This makes the environment less appealing for them to inhabit.
-
Contact Insecticide: When applied directly to cockroaches, citrus oils can disrupt their physiological processes. Limonene and other compounds can penetrate the exoskeleton and interfere with cellular functions.
-
Antifeedant Effects: Citrus scents can also act as an antifeedant, deterring cockroaches from consuming food sources in treated areas.
Safety Profile
One of the most significant advantages of using citrus oils is their safety profile compared to traditional insecticides. Citrus oils are generally recognized as safe (GRAS) by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) when used appropriately. They pose minimal risk to humans and pets while being effective against pests.
Application Methods for Citrus Oils
To effectively manage cockroach populations using citrus oils, proper application is crucial. Here are some methods for using citrus oils in cockroach management:
1. Homemade Citrus Spray
A simple yet effective method is to create your own citrus oil spray:
- Ingredients:
- 1 cup water
- 1 tablespoon lemon or orange essential oil
-
A few drops of liquid soap (optional)
-
Instructions:
- Combine water and citrus oil in a spray bottle.
- If using soap, add it to help emulsify the oil for better distribution.
- Shake well before each use.
- Spray areas where you suspect cockroach activity—focus on cracks, crevices, and entry points.
2. Citrus Oil Soaked Cotton Balls
Another method involves soaking cotton balls in citrus oil:
- Instructions:
- Soak cotton balls in lemon or orange oil.
- Place them strategically around your home—under sinks, behind appliances, and in corners.
This method not only repels roaches but also leaves a pleasant scent in your living space.

4. Cleaning Solutions
Incorporating citrus oils into your cleaning regimen can help prevent future infestations:
- Add a few drops of lemon or orange essential oil to your regular cleaning solution.
- Use this mixture to clean surfaces in kitchens and bathrooms where roaches tend to thrive.
Tips for Effective Use of Citrus Oils
To maximize the effectiveness of citrus oils in cockroach management:
-
Regular Application: Reapply every few days or after cleaning surfaces where sprays have been washed away.
-
Combine with Other Natural Remedies: For enhanced results, combine citrus oils with other natural repellents like diatomaceous earth or boric acid.
-
Maintain Cleanliness: While citrus oils help repel roaches, maintaining a clean environment is crucial for long-term management.
Limitations of Citrus Oils
While citrus oils offer many benefits as a natural pest control solution, they do have limitations:
-
Limited Efficacy Against Large Infestations: For severe infestations, professional pest control may still be required.
-
Transient Effects: The effectiveness may diminish over time as the scent fades; continuous application is necessary.
-
Potential Allergies: Some individuals may be sensitive or allergic to certain essential oils; caution should be exercised when using them.
